Accessing public records, specifically Roanoke Virginia mugshots, is a process governed by the principles of open government and the Freedom of Information Act (FOIA). In the Roanoke Valley, the maintenance of arrest records and booking photos falls under the jurisdiction of local law enforcement agencies and the regional jail system. Understanding how these records are created, maintained, and accessed is essential for residents, legal professionals, and journalists alike.

When an individual is processed by the Roanoke City Police Department or the Roanoke County Sheriff’s Office, they undergo a standard booking procedure. This includes fingerprinting, basic demographic data collection, and the capture of a booking photograph—commonly known as a mugshot. These records serve a specific administrative purpose: identifying the individual, establishing a physical record of their status at the time of arrest, and ensuring that court proceedings are accurately documented.



The Mechanism of Roanoke County and City Records

The legal framework surrounding mugshots in Virginia has evolved significantly. While these images are technically public records, their availability online is dictated by the policies of the specific holding facility. In Roanoke, the Western Virginia Regional Jail often serves as the primary repository for individuals arrested within the jurisdiction. Accessing these records requires navigating the specific portals provided by the Sheriff’s offices or the regional jail's administrative software.

It is important to recognize the distinction between a "mugshot" and an "official criminal record." A mugshot represents only the point of entry into the justice system. It does not reflect the outcome of a trial, the dropping of charges, or an acquittal. Because mugshots are visual, they are frequently misunderstood by the public as evidence of guilt, which is a fundamental misunderstanding of the legal principle of "presumed innocent until proven guilty."

Understanding the Legal Status of Public Booking Photos

The dissemination of booking photos has been a subject of significant debate regarding privacy and the impact on the judicial process. In recent years, Virginia has seen legislative shifts aimed at balancing the public’s right to information with the rights of individuals who have not been convicted of a crime. When you search for Roanoke Virginia mugshots, you are interacting with data that sits at this intersection of public transparency and individual reputation.

From a technical standpoint, the database management for these records is handled by integrated justice information systems. These systems track the movement of an inmate from the initial arrest by local officers to their transport to the detention center. The data is then synthesized into public-facing portals. Understanding this flow helps in troubleshooting why a name might not appear in a search; if a person was processed through a state police barracks rather than local city police, the portal for information retrieval might differ.

Professional legal researchers often prefer to go directly to the Roanoke Clerk of Court’s database rather than relying on mugshot portals. This is because the Clerk’s office maintains the actual case status, including sentencing orders, plea agreements, and dismissal documents. A mugshot is a static image, but the court file is a dynamic record of the legal truth.

The Process: How to Access Records Safely

For those who need to access specific criminal records for background checks or legal due diligence, the process is straightforward but requires attention to detail.



  1. Identify the Jurisdiction: Determine if the arrest occurred within the Roanoke City limits or the surrounding Roanoke County. Jurisdiction dictates which Sheriff’s department maintains the file.
  2. Access the Official Portal: Navigate to the Roanoke County Sheriff’s office website or the Western Virginia Regional Jail inmate search feature.
  3. Input Necessary Identifiers: Use the full legal name and, if available, the date of birth. Avoid nicknames, as these databases are structured for legal identification.
  4. Interpret the Results: Pay close attention to the "Status" or "Charge" fields. Always prioritize information regarding court dates and legal counsel over the visual booking photograph.


Frequently Asked Questions

1. Are mugshots from Roanoke publicly available online? Yes, most booking photos are considered public records under Virginia law, though they may be removed from official sites once a case is closed or if specific privacy statutes apply.

2. Can I get a mugshot removed from a private website? Yes. If a private third-party site has published your image, you can contact their site administrator to request removal. Many reputable services comply with these requests, especially if the charges were dismissed.

3. Does a mugshot indicate that I have a criminal record? No. A mugshot only indicates that an arrest occurred. It is not evidence of a conviction or a criminal record.

4. What is the difference between a City and County arrest record? The primary difference is the arresting agency and the facility of detention. Roanoke City PD and Roanoke County Sheriff operate as distinct entities, although they may house inmates in the same regional jail facility.

5. How do I find court outcomes for a specific arrest? You should visit the Virginia Judiciary Online Case Information System (OCIS) to view the final disposition of any court case related to the arrest.
